Types of Investment Loans Available
When it comes to investment loans, there are several types available, each catering to different investment strategies and financial situations. The most common types include fixed-rate loans, variable-rate loans, and interest-only loans. Fixed-rate loans offer stability, as the interest rate remains constant throughout the loan term, making it easier for investors to budget their repayments.
On the other hand, variable-rate loans can fluctuate with market conditions, potentially offering lower initial rates but with the risk of increases over time. Interest-only loans are another popular option among investors, allowing borrowers to pay only the interest for a specified period, typically between 5 to 10 years. This can significantly reduce monthly repayments during the interest-only period, freeing up cash flow for other investments or expenses.
Additionally, there are specialized investment loans such as low-doc loans for self-employed individuals and commercial property loans for those looking to invest in business premises.
Understanding these various types of investment loans is crucial for selecting the right one that aligns with your financial goals and investment strategy.
Benefits of Investment Loans
Investment loans offer numerous benefits that can enhance an investor’s financial portfolio. One of the primary advantages is the ability to leverage borrowed funds to acquire properties without needing to use all your savings. This means you can invest in multiple properties simultaneously, increasing your potential for rental income and capital growth.
By using an investment loan, you can diversify your portfolio and spread risk across different assets. Another significant benefit of investment loans is the potential tax advantages they offer. In many cases, the interest paid on investment loans is tax-deductible, allowing investors to reduce their taxable income.
Additionally, expenses related to managing and maintaining the investment property can also be claimed as tax deductions. This can lead to substantial savings over time, making investment loans an attractive option for those looking to maximize their returns on property investments.

Factors to Consider When Choosing an Investment Loan
When selecting an investment loan, several critical factors should be taken into account to ensure you make an informed decision. First and foremost is the interest rate; whether fixed or variable, this will significantly impact your overall repayment amount. A lower interest rate can save you thousands over the life of the loan, so it’s essential to shop around and compare offers from different lenders.
Another important factor is the loan-to-value ratio (LVR), which determines how much you can borrow relative to the property’s value. A higher LVR may allow you to invest with less upfront capital but could also mean higher fees and insurance costs. Additionally, consider any associated fees such as establishment fees, ongoing fees, and exit fees that could affect your overall borrowing costs.
Lastly, evaluate the flexibility of the loan terms; features like offset accounts or redraw facilities can provide additional financial benefits and flexibility as your investment strategy evolves.
How to Apply for an Investment Loan
Applying for an investment loan involves several steps that require careful preparation and documentation. The first step is to gather all necessary financial documents, including proof of income, tax returns, bank statements, and details of any existing debts or assets. Lenders will assess your financial situation to determine your borrowing capacity and eligibility for an investment loan.
Once you have your documents in order, it’s time to approach lenders or mortgage brokers to discuss your options. They will guide you through the application process and help you complete any required forms. Be prepared for a thorough assessment by the lender, which may include credit checks and property valuations.
After submitting your application, it’s essential to stay in communication with your lender or broker to address any questions or additional information they may require promptly.
Investment Loan Interest Rates and Terms
Interest rates on investment loans can vary significantly based on several factors, including market conditions, lender policies, and your creditworthiness as a borrower. Generally speaking, investment loan rates tend to be higher than those for owner-occupied home loans due to the increased risk associated with investment properties. However, securing a competitive interest rate is crucial for maximizing your returns on investment.
Loan terms also play a vital role in determining your overall repayment strategy. Most lenders offer terms ranging from 15 to 30 years; however, shorter terms may come with higher monthly repayments but less interest paid over time. It’s essential to consider how long you plan to hold onto the property and how that aligns with your financial goals when choosing the right loan term.
Risks Associated with Investment Loans
While investment loans can be a powerful tool for building wealth, they also come with inherent risks that investors must be aware of before proceeding. One significant risk is market volatility; property values can fluctuate due to economic conditions, which may impact your ability to sell or refinance in the future. If property values decline significantly, you could find yourself owing more than the property’s worth—a situation known as being “underwater.” Another risk involves cash flow management; if rental income does not cover mortgage repayments and other expenses, you may face financial strain.
It’s crucial to conduct thorough research on potential rental yields and ensure that you have a buffer in place for unexpected costs or vacancies. Additionally, changes in interest rates can affect your repayments if you opt for a variable-rate loan; being prepared for potential increases is essential for maintaining financial stability.

Investment Loan Strategies for Success
To maximize the benefits of investment loans, it’s essential to implement effective strategies tailored to your individual goals and circumstances. One successful strategy is conducting thorough market research before purchasing an investment property; understanding local trends and demand can help identify high-growth areas where property values are likely to increase. Another strategy involves focusing on cash flow management; ensuring that rental income covers mortgage repayments and other expenses is crucial for maintaining financial stability.
Consider investing in properties that offer strong rental yields or exploring opportunities for value-adding renovations that can increase both rental income and property value over time. Additionally, regularly reviewing your investment portfolio and refinancing options can help ensure you are taking advantage of competitive interest rates and favorable loan terms as market conditions change.
